I have a pizza veggie dip that I ADORE and it always goes over well.
It started with a recipe but is so basic you don't really need one. It includes: -cream cheese (chive and onion, or just plain) -garlic (fresh if you want to mess with it, or a sprinkling of powder) -spaghetti sauce -whatever other cheeses you have on hand: parmesan, mozzarella, provolone... you can layer it like the original recipe (cream cheese on bottom, sauce, cheese on top) or just mix it all together like it will get mixed after the first several dips anyway. just bake it in the oven at 350-375 until cheese is melted/heated through. :yum now I want some! |
